vintage

(noun, adjective, verb)

adjective

1. (attributively) Of or relating to a vintage, or to wine identified by a specific vintage.

2. (attributively) Having an enduring appeal; high-quality

3. (attributively) Classic (such as video or computer games from the 1980s and early 1990s, or old magazines, etc.).

4. (attributively) Of a motor car, built between the years 1919 and (usually) 1930 (or sometimes 1919 to 1925 in the USA).

5. Of a watch, produced between the years 1870 and 1980.

noun

1. a season's yield of wine from a vineyard

2. the oldness of wines

verb

1. (transitive) To harvest (grapes).

2. (transitive) To make (wine) from grapes.
